Latest Patents

One of Shu-Fang Chu's most recent patents is titled "Compound for inactivating viruses and bacteria and method of making same." This invention discloses a novel compound, 2-(10-mercaptodecyl)-propanedioic acid or its salts, which has been shown to disrupt, break down, or inactivate viruses and bacteria. This compound plays a vital role in suppressing infection and proliferation in host cells. The patent also includes a method for chemically synthesizing this innovative compound.
